Comparative efficacy of certoparin, enoxaparin, and combined thromboprophylaxis on thromboembolic events after glioblastoma resection: a prospective observational study
Abstract Thromboembolic events (TE) are serious complications following glioblastoma (GBM) resection. This retrospective study analyzed 695 GBM patients (2017–2022, University Hospital Dresden) to assess the impact of different anticoagulant regimens—certoparin, enoxaparin, and enoxaparin with inter...
